Review on Rhosyn Restaurant at Penally Abbey Country House Hotel
Rated as one of Pembrokeshire's loveliest Gothic-style country houses, Penally Abbey stands next to the Norman church in a pretty, floral village not far from Tenby. There are magnificent sea views over Caldey Island and Carmarthen Bay from grounds that surround the ivy-clad mansion.
Guests dine in the newly refurbished Rhosyn Restaurant, meaning rose in Welsh its a relaxed affair with friendly and accomplished service. It has a chic décor with high coved ceilings, hand-carved fireplaces and crystal chandeliers, affording guests lovely views of the garden through the large ogee-arched windows. The kitchen makes good use of Welsh produce for a menu in the European mould of smoked salmon and trout gâteau, fillet of lamb with port and redcurrants and dark chocolate torte.
